Output 57da50cdbf7e6cc5a7a71dcedc6bc7118348e7044cd41822e36ca102485e6de5:1

value
512531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c482871d29134f3c30a197081f4d522d92a0a88 OP_EQUAL
address
3A6xXpLYENyssC9w8jCxkL5q6ahSNtc2Cc
transaction
57da50cdbf7e6cc5a7a71dcedc6bc7118348e7044cd41822e36ca102485e6de5
confirmations
78562
spent
true